Individuality of calves: linking personality traits to feeding and activity daily patterns measured by precision livestock technology.

Animal personality has established connections with animal performance, resilience, and welfare which are related to stable behavioral patterns. Precision livestock technologies introduce the opportunity to measure these behavior patterns automatically and non-invasively. Thus, the primary aim of this study was to determine if personality traits in dairy calves measured via standardized personality assessments were associated with activity measured via a commercially available accelerometer. Secondary aims of this study were to investigate if personality traits were associated with feeding behaviors measured via an automatic feeding system (AFS) and with average daily gain (ADG). We characterized personality traits of Holstein calves (n = 49) utilizing standardized personality (novel environment, novel person, novel object, and startle) tests. Behaviors from these tests were summarized and 3 factors were extracted from a principal component analysis to represent calf personality traits: ‘fearful', ‘active', and ‘explorative'. Factor scores were regressed against behaviors from the accelerometer and AFS and with ADG. We found that calves that were more ‘active' were associated with taking more steps in the home environment, consuming more calf starter, and with hitting the benchmark of 1 kg of starter consumed in a day at a younger age. The trait ‘active' was also associated with greater ADG throughout the study. Additionally, calves that were more ‘explorative' in the personality tests were associated with less starter consumed and lower ADG specifically during the weaning period. The findings of this research contribute to the existing literature by further establishing the links between personality traits and the daily behavioral patterns and performance of young calves. This study suggests the potential for using precision technology to assess and characterize personality traits, thereby enhancing their practical applicability on farms. Future research should focus on evaluating how personality traits, as measured through standardized assessments and precision technologies, correlate with deviations in behavior observed in dairy calves during stressors.
